What does a typical day look like for a Prototyping Engineer?

A typical day for a Prototyping Engineer often involves collaborating with design and development teams to translate concepts and sketches into working physical models. You may spend time using CAD software, operating fabrication equipment like 3D printers, and assembling or testing prototypes for functionality. Troubleshooting issues and iterating designs based on test results are frequent tasks. This role requires consistent teamwork with engineers, designers, and sometimes clients to ensure the prototyping process aligns with overall project goals.

What is a Prototyping Engineer job?

A Prototyping Engineer is responsible for designing, developing, and testing prototypes of new products or components. They work with design teams to refine concepts, select materials, and ensure that prototypes meet functional and performance requirements. This role involves using various fabrication techniques, such as 3D printing, CNC machining, and electronics assembly. Prototyping Engineers collaborate with R&D, manufacturing, and quality teams to iterate and improve designs before full-scale production. Their goal is to validate ideas quickly and efficiently, reducing development time and costs.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Prototyping Engineer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Prototyping Engineer, you need strong skills in mechanical or electrical engineering, rapid prototyping, and CAD design, usually supported by a relevant engineering degree. Knowledge of 3D printing, CNC machining, and prototyping software (such as SolidWorks or AutoCAD) is typically essential, along with familiarity with relevant safety standards. Creative problem-solving, collaboration, and effective communication are valuable soft skills in this role. These abilities enable engineers to quickly turn ideas into functional prototypes, ensuring efficient product development and iterative testing.

The Bike Shop department is seeking a Prototype Engineering Planner to work in an engineering environment to manage developmental engineering hardware in accordance with customer and internal requirements, as well as industry standards. Candidates will collaborate with multi-disciplined design teams across multiple projects to bring design concepts to fruition, providing rapid engineering, fabrication, and prototyping solutions throughout the entire product lifecycle. 

This position is an onsite role, located in Tucson, AZ.

What You Will Do:

  • Analyze engineering drawings, associated documentation, and quality standards to develop manufacturing work methodologies, instructions, and illustrations.
  • Generate and document the "as-built" configuration by capturing the build bill of materials (BOM).
  • Ensure Quality, Cost, and Schedule Compliance
  • Ensure engineering hardware meets quality, cost, and schedule requirements.
  • Identify and implement process improvements for efficiency and performance.
  • Perform BOM Analysis and Material Management
  • Conduct BOM analysis, purchase components, and generate material status reports
  • Request components from engineering stores and manage the disposition of quality discrepancies and non-conformances.

Qualifications You Must Have:

  • Typically requires a Bachelor’s in Science, Technology, Engineering, or Mathematics (STEM) and less than one year of prior relevant experience to include any combination of the following:
  • Experience working with complex processes and tools, including inventory control and material procurement databases.
  • Experience performing supplier quoting and interface activities to support procurement and supply chain functions.
